     Former Army Officer Mark Deuger will give a presentation on Winter Warfare at 1 p.m. on Saturday, January 21 at the Fort Devens Museum. Mark served in the Infantry and Special Forces in Alaska, Massachusetts (Fort Devens), and Colorado, among other assignments. He participated in a wide range...
